ZIP Code 94024
ZIP / ZCTA
Population: 23,673
ZIP Code Tabulation Areas (ZCTAs) are Census approximations of USPS ZIP codes. Boundaries may differ slightly from postal delivery areas, and estimates for less-populated ZCTAs carry higher margins of error.
Data: U.S. Census Bureau, ACS 5-Year Estimates, 2023 (released December 2024).
Quick Facts — 94024
- What is the median household income in 94024?
-
The median household income in 94024 is $250,001 (U.S. Census Bureau ACS 5-Year Estimates, 2023).
- What is the poverty rate in 94024?
-
The poverty rate in 94024 is 2.5% (U.S. Census Bureau ACS 2023).
- What is the median home value in 94024?
-
$2,000,001 (U.S. Census Bureau ACS 2023).
- What is the average rent in 94024?
-
The median gross rent in 94024 is $3,501 per month (U.S. Census Bureau ACS 2023).
- What percentage of 94024 residents have a college degree?
-
85.1% of adults in 94024 hold a bachelor's degree or higher (U.S. Census Bureau ACS 2023).
